Crystal Rock
Crystal Rock is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Erie County, Ohio, United States. As of the 2020 census it had a population of 138. It is located within Margaretta Township.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Edison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Mapsax,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Thomas A. Edison Memorial Bridge, or the Edison Bridge, carries Ohio State Routes 2 and 269 over Sandusky Bay. The bridge, which is 2,049 feet in length, was completed in 1965. It was named for inventor and nearby Milan native Thomas Edison. Edison Bridge is situated 2½ miles north of Crystal Rock.

Gypsum
Hamlet
Gypsum is an unincorporated community in eastern Portage Township, Ottawa County, Ohio, United States. It has a post office with the ZIP code 43433. The community is named for deposits of the gypsum rock near the original town site. Gypsum is situated 3½ miles northwest of Crystal Rock.
Castalia
Village
Photo: Nyttend, Public domain.
Castalia is a village in Erie County, Ohio, United States. The population was 774 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Sandusky, Ohio Metropolitan Statistical Area. Castalia is situated 3½ miles southeast of Crystal Rock.
